The integration of concrete solutions in urban mobility not only supports structural stability but also promotes sustainability. Eco-friendly concrete mixes, which utilize recycled materials and reduce carbon emissions, are becoming increasingly popular. For example, the incorporation of supplementary cementitious materials like fly ash and slag can drastically reduce the carbon footprint of concrete, contributing to greener cityscapes.

Beyond environmental benefits, concrete's versatility is crucial in designing adaptable urban transit systems. For instance, precast concrete elements can be tailored to fit specific spatial constraints and aesthetic requirements, ensuring that transit stations and platforms are both functional and visually appealing. This flexibility supports the seamless integration of various transit modes, including light rail, subways, and electric buses, creating a cohesive and efficient urban transportation network.

Concrete solutions also play a pivotal role in safety and accessibility within public transit systems. Non-slip concrete surfaces, for instance, enhance pedestrian safety, while ramps and tactile paving ensure accessibility for individuals with disabilities. These features not only comply with urban planning regulations but also enhance the commuter experience, encouraging public transit use.
